A 21-year-old college student from Pennsylvania is confronting attempts of homicide charges after an incident involving a police officer on October 24 in Plymouth Township. Dalton Lee Janiczek allegedly ran over an officer on three occasions before fleeing the scene and ultimately colliding head-on with a police cruiser on the highway.The confrontation began when an officer attempted to halt a white Mercedes G-Wagon, which then sped off erratically, crossing a concrete barrier. Approximately an hour later, authorities located the vehicle at a local hotel. When an officer posted behind the car and engaged his emergency lights, Janiczek reportedly reversed, striking the police cruiser multiple times. After the officer exited the vehicle and instructed Janiczek to stop, he accelerated toward the officer, knocking him down.While the officer was immobilized, Janiczek allegedly circled the parking lot, running over him three times before fleeing, leading to a brief chase that resulted in another collision with a police vehicle. Both injured officers were hospitalized, one undergoing emergency surgery. Janiczek remains incarcerated without bond, facing serious felony charges.
